diff --git a/api-ref/source/v1/rating/hashmap.rst b/api-ref/source/v1/rating/hashmap.rst index c24abbb0..02eee8a0 100644 --- a/api-ref/source/v1/rating/hashmap.rst +++ b/api-ref/source/v1/rating/hashmap.rst @@ -8,41 +8,41 @@ HashMap Module REST API .. rest-controller:: cloudkitty.rating.hash.controllers.service:HashMapServicesController :webprefix: /v1/rating/module_config/hashmap/services -.. autotype:: cloudkitty.rating.hash.datamodels.service.Service +.. autoclass:: cloudkitty.rating.hash.datamodels.service.Service :members: -.. autotype:: cloudkitty.rating.hash.datamodels.service.ServiceCollection +.. autoclass:: cloudkitty.rating.hash.datamodels.service.ServiceCollection :members: .. rest-controller:: cloudkitty.rating.hash.controllers.field:HashMapFieldsController :webprefix: /v1/rating/module_config/hashmap/fields -.. autotype:: cloudkitty.rating.hash.datamodels.field.Field +.. autoclass:: cloudkitty.rating.hash.datamodels.field.Field :members: -.. autotype:: cloudkitty.rating.hash.datamodels.field.FieldCollection +.. autoclass:: cloudkitty.rating.hash.datamodels.field.FieldCollection :members: .. rest-controller:: cloudkitty.rating.hash.controllers.mapping:HashMapMappingsController :webprefix: /v1/rating/module_config/hashmap/mappings -.. autotype:: cloudkitty.rating.hash.datamodels.mapping.Mapping +.. autoclass:: cloudkitty.rating.hash.datamodels.mapping.Mapping :members: -.. autotype:: cloudkitty.rating.hash.datamodels.mapping.MappingCollection +.. autoclass:: cloudkitty.rating.hash.datamodels.mapping.MappingCollection :members: -.. autotype:: cloudkitty.rating.hash.datamodels.threshold.Threshold +.. autoclass:: cloudkitty.rating.hash.datamodels.threshold.Threshold :members: -.. autotype:: cloudkitty.rating.hash.datamodels.threshold.ThresholdCollection +.. autoclass:: cloudkitty.rating.hash.datamodels.threshold.ThresholdCollection :members: .. rest-controller:: cloudkitty.rating.hash.controllers.group:HashMapGroupsController :webprefix: /v1/rating/module_config/hashmap/groups -.. autotype:: cloudkitty.rating.hash.datamodels.group.Group +.. autoclass:: cloudkitty.rating.hash.datamodels.group.Group :members: -.. autotype:: cloudkitty.rating.hash.datamodels.group.GroupCollection +.. autoclass:: cloudkitty.rating.hash.datamodels.group.GroupCollection :members: diff --git a/api-ref/source/v1/rating/pyscripts.rst b/api-ref/source/v1/rating/pyscripts.rst index 8fd00883..bf4f2629 100644 --- a/api-ref/source/v1/rating/pyscripts.rst +++ b/api-ref/source/v1/rating/pyscripts.rst @@ -8,8 +8,8 @@ PyScripts Module REST API .. rest-controller:: cloudkitty.rating.pyscripts.controllers.script:PyScriptsScriptsController :webprefix: /v1/rating/module_config/pyscripts/scripts -.. autotype:: cloudkitty.rating.pyscripts.datamodels.script.Script +.. autoclass:: cloudkitty.rating.pyscripts.datamodels.script.Script :members: -.. autotype:: cloudkitty.rating.pyscripts.datamodels.script.ScriptCollection +.. autoclass:: cloudkitty.rating.pyscripts.datamodels.script.ScriptCollection :members: diff --git a/api-ref/source/v1/v1.rst b/api-ref/source/v1/v1.rst index 6977ad7f..af5e4476 100644 --- a/api-ref/source/v1/v1.rst +++ b/api-ref/source/v1/v1.rst @@ -14,13 +14,13 @@ Collector .. rest-controller:: cloudkitty.api.v1.controllers.collector:CollectorStateController :webprefix: /v1/collector/states -.. autotype:: cloudkitty.api.v1.datamodels.collector.CollectorInfos +.. autoclass:: cloudkitty.api.v1.datamodels.collector.CollectorInfos :members: -.. autotype:: cloudkitty.api.v1.datamodels.collector.ServiceToCollectorMapping +.. autoclass:: cloudkitty.api.v1.datamodels.collector.ServiceToCollectorMapping :members: -.. autotype:: cloudkitty.api.v1.datamodels.collector.ServiceToCollectorMappingCollection +.. autoclass:: cloudkitty.api.v1.datamodels.collector.ServiceToCollectorMappingCollection :members: @@ -33,10 +33,10 @@ Info .. rest-controller:: cloudkitty.api.v1.controllers.info:MetricInfoController :webprefix: /v1/info/metric -.. autotype:: cloudkitty.api.v1.datamodels.info.CloudkittyMetricInfo +.. autoclass:: cloudkitty.api.v1.datamodels.info.CloudkittyMetricInfo :members: -.. autotype:: cloudkitty.api.v1.datamodels.info.CloudkittyMetricInfoCollection +.. autoclass:: cloudkitty.api.v1.datamodels.info.CloudkittyMetricInfoCollection :members: .. rest-controller:: cloudkitty.api.v1.controllers.info:ServiceInfoController @@ -55,16 +55,16 @@ Rating .. rest-controller:: cloudkitty.api.v1.controllers.rating:RatingController :webprefix: /v1/rating -.. autotype:: cloudkitty.api.v1.datamodels.rating.CloudkittyModule +.. autoclass:: cloudkitty.api.v1.datamodels.rating.CloudkittyModule :members: -.. autotype:: cloudkitty.api.v1.datamodels.rating.CloudkittyModuleCollection +.. autoclass:: cloudkitty.api.v1.datamodels.rating.CloudkittyModuleCollection :members: -.. autotype:: cloudkitty.api.v1.datamodels.rating.CloudkittyResource +.. autoclass:: cloudkitty.api.v1.datamodels.rating.CloudkittyResource :members: -.. autotype:: cloudkitty.api.v1.datamodels.rating.CloudkittyResourceCollection +.. autoclass:: cloudkitty.api.v1.datamodels.rating.CloudkittyResourceCollection :members: @@ -84,11 +84,11 @@ Storage .. rest-controller:: cloudkitty.api.v1.controllers.storage:DataFramesController :webprefix: /v1/storage/dataframes -.. autotype:: cloudkitty.api.v1.datamodels.storage.RatedResource +.. autoclass:: cloudkitty.api.v1.datamodels.storage.RatedResource :members: -.. autotype:: cloudkitty.api.v1.datamodels.storage.DataFrame +.. autoclass:: cloudkitty.api.v1.datamodels.storage.DataFrame :members: -.. autotype:: cloudkitty.api.v1.datamodels.storage.DataFrameCollection +.. autoclass:: cloudkitty.api.v1.datamodels.storage.DataFrameCollection :members: